Meaning
means(noun) the least favorable outcome; "the worst that could happen"
worst
means(noun) the greatest damage or wickedness of which one is capable; "the invaders did their worst"; "so pure of heart that his worst is another man's best"
worst
means(noun) the weakest effort or poorest achievement one is capable of; "it was the worst he had ever done on a test"
worst
means(verb) defeat thoroughly; "He mopped up the floor with his opponents"
worst, rack up, pip, mop up, whip
means(adjective) (superlative of `bad') most wanting in quality or value or condition; "the worst player on the team"; "the worst weather of the year"
worst
means(adverb) to the highest degree of inferiority or badness; "She suffered worst of all"; "schools were the worst hit by government spending cuts"; "the worst dressed person present"
